If you have the time, why not broaden your horizons and discover the many delights to be found in Normandy while you're in the area? Visit Normandy's ruins and castles and also see the region's rural landscapes, beaches and coastal plains. In this fascinating part of France visitors may partake in rock climbing.
Consider spending some time seeing Chateau d'Eu and Jardin Jungle Karlostachys, in Eu, 45 miles (72 kilometers) northeast of Montigny. The Domaine de Joinville & Spa and Inter Hotel La Cour Carree are just some of the short and long-stay alternatives in Eu. Alternatively, you could consider staying at Fecamp, 35 miles (55 kilometers) to the northwest of Montigny, where you'll find the Le Grand Pavois and Inter-hotel D Angleterre. If you're staying in Fecamp, set aside a little time to visit the Fecamp Beach and Benedictine Distillery.
